#695e2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#695e2e is composed of 41.2% red, 36.9%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.5% magenta, 56.2%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 48.8 degrees, a saturation of 39.1% and a lightness of 29.6%. #695e2e color hex could be obtained by blending #d2bc5c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#695e2e color description : Very dark desaturated yellow.
#695e2e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#695e2e has RGB values of R:105, G:94,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.56,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6905390.
